From 6a88e04ae474646b9aa366da538d552cda5a8f19 Mon Sep 17 00:00:00 2001 From: Zac Medico Date: Sat, 29 Mar 2008 00:02:11 +0000 Subject: Don't trigger the 'java.eclassesnotused' on blocker atoms. svn path=/main/trunk/; revision=9586 --- bin/repoman |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) (limited to 'bin') diff --git a/bin/repoman b/bin/repoman index 4d7aa19ca..1ebf71d58 100755 --- a/bin/repoman +++ b/bin/repoman @@ -1159,8 +1159,12 @@ for x in scanlist: if not portage.isvalidatom(token, allow_blockers=True): badsyntax.append("'%s' not a valid atom" % token) else: - atom = token.lstrip("!") + atom = token + is_blocker = atom.startswith("!") + if is_blocker: + atom = token.lstrip("!") if mytype == "DEPEND" and \ + not is_blocker and \ not inherited_java_eclass and \ portage.dep_getkey(atom) == "virtual/jdk": stats['java.eclassesnotused'] += 1 -- cgit v1.2.3-1-g7c22